Blaze EMS-2 Operating Manual Page 3
Manifold Pressure
Manifold pressure can be displayed in millibar (mB) or in inches of Mercury (“Hg”).
Records maximum MAP reached in permanent memory
MGL Avionics RDAC-XF MAP required
Timers
Displays both UTC (Zulu time) and local time
Time is maintained by an internal lithium battery which can be replaced by the user
Includes a settable Hobbs meter which is password protected
Includes an engine running and flight timer
Includes a programmable maintenance timer for scheduled routine engine maintenance
Provides a 50 entry flight log that stores the start time and duration of each of the last 50 flights. The flight
timer can either be started automatically or by using a front push button
Volts
Can measure voltages up to 30V (compatible with both 12V and 24V aircraft supplies)
Contains a programmable low/high voltage alarm to automatically detect alternator failures and bad
batteries
Records maximum and minimum Volts reached in permanent memory
Current (RDAC connection)
Uses the MGL Avionics Closed Loop Current Sensor to measure the aircrafts current load.
Records maximum and minimum current reached in permanent memory
UL Power ECU Display
Displays engine information from the UL Power ECU (Engine Control Unit) via the RS232 port
The EMS-2 has a dedicated UL Power ECU display screen
Displays warning messages from the UL Power ECU
Rotax 912is (MGL Avionics CAN RDAC Required)
Displays engine information from the Rotax 912is ECU via the RDAC-CAN interface
The EMS-2 has a dedicated Rotax 912is display screens
Displays Engine, Sensor and Device Status messages from the Rotax 921is ECU
